I have an HP Pavilion g6 (refer to image of the BIOS for the tech details) BIOS version f.26, vendor: insyde, which I want to dual boot with Ubuntu 14.04.

I have done the following so far:

  1. created a 150 GB partition where I intend to load Ubuntu
  2. created a live USB of Ubuntu 14.04
  3. disabled fast boot
  4. enabled legacy boot in UEFI
  5. disabled secure boot in UEFI

The trouble is, for a reason yet unknown to me, the machine still boots straight into Windows, and when I press F9 to select boot from UEFI, it takes me to some folders where I get lost. These are the images of the machine and the error I got when I attempted to boot into UEFI mode.

Problem : i can boot ubuntu but cannot boot windows 8, think twice before you act, if you wish to boot ubuntu very much try the following steps

Step: Press windows key + I, a small window should appear on the right Press change pc settings Press update and recovery, choose recovery, and then press restart button of advanced setup Press troubleshoot (refresh/reset your pc, or use advanced tools), and press advanced options, choose UEFI firmware settings, press restart button

Choose BIOS setup and then boot option Press arrows to select security Then you can see OS manager, USB drive/hard drive, etc, change the order, the one holding Ubuntu should be on the top Save and exit
